DB-Lib error”的错误。此错误通常出现在执行SQL查询语句时,表示在查询中靠近FROM关键字的地方存在语法错误。...DB-Lib error”的原因主要有以下几点: SQL语法错误:在查询中存在拼写错误、缺少关键字或符号等问题。 缺少必要的空格:关键字之间缺少必要的空格。...表名或列名错误:表名或列名拼写错误或不存在。 SQL查询不完整:查询语句未正确结束或缺少必要的部分。...WHERE age > 18" # 确保语法正确 cursor.execute(query) # 获取结果 results = cursor.fetchall() print(results)...验证表名和列名:确保表名和列名正确无误,避免拼写错误或使用不存在的表或列。 调试和测试:在执行复杂查询之前,先在数据库管理工具中测试查询,以确保其正确性。
PostgreSQL报错:cannot begin/end transactions in PL/pgSQL解决方法 出现此问题一般都是代码格式错误,或者代码块中出现了PostgreSQL中不应该出现的语法...,语法错误。...ERROR: cannot begin/end transactions in PL/pgSQL HINT: Use a BEGIN block with an EXCEPTION clause instead...CONTEXT: PL/pgSQL function “fun_td_xxx_xxx_result” line 845 at SQL statement ********** 错误 *********...* ERROR: cannot begin/end transactions in PL/pgSQL SQL 状态: 0A000 指导建议:Use a BEGIN block with an EXCEPTION
(482): error C2143: 语法错误: 缺少“)”(在“*”的前面) d:\mysql-5.6.37-winx64\include\mysql_com.h(482): error C2143...: 语法错误: 缺少“{”(在“*”的前面) d:\mysql-5.6.37-winx64\include\mysql_com.h(482): error C2371: “Vio”: 重定义;不同的基类型...(482): error C2143: 语法错误: 缺少“;”(在“*”的前面) d:\mysql-5.6.37-winx64\include\mysql_com.h(482): error C2059...: 语法错误:“)” d:\mysql-5.6.37-winx64\include\mysql_com.h(483): error C2143: 语法错误: 缺少“)”(在“*”的前面) d:\mysql...-5.6.37-winx64\include\mysql_com.h(483): error C2143: 语法错误: 缺少“{”(在“*”的前面) .... d:\mysql-5.6.37-winx64
where command_tag='authentication' and error_severity= 'FATAL' and log_time > c1; update public.t_login...create user test1 encrypted password 'XXX'; 模拟test1用户登录失败,输入错误密码。...select * from postgres_log where command_tag='authentication' and error_severity= 'FATAL'; 可以看到1条数据,手工插入一条登录失败的信息到...update t_login set flag = 0 where user_name='test1' and flag=1; 总结 1. session_exec通过用户登录成功后调用login函数去实现锁定登录失败次数过多的用户...,擅长于PL/PGsql业务迁移及优化,Oracle到PostgreSQL的迁移升级,异构数据库整合;作为墨天轮PostgreSQL专栏作者,热衷于PostgreSQL实践技术分享,在自己的岗位积极推广
下面是我们整理的php的laravel学习的常见的错误以及解决的办法,我还会持续更新,请关注 ---- ---- ## 错误1: 错误代码: No message 错误原因: 查看这个路由参数,缺少参数...::where('user_id',$user_id)->whereIn('accessable',['public','protected'])->toSql() 改为 Blog::where('user_id...',$user_id) ->whereIn('accessable',['public','protected'])->get(); ---- ---- ## 错误4: 错误代码: Parse error...\test\resources\views\face\face.blade.php 错误原因: 解析错误:语法错误、意想不到的“$DATA”(TY变量)、期望“、”或“”(视图:D:\ SHIXXIIA...\LARAVEL123\Test\Reals\View \Foo\FACE.BLADE.PHP 解决办法: 解析错误:语法错误、意想不到的“$DATA”(TY变量)、期望“、”或“”(视图:D:\ SHIXXIIA
读 内存架构&典型进程 postgres> pstree -p 9687 -+= 00001 root /sbin/launchd \-+- 09687 postgres /usr/local/pgsql.../bin/postgres -D /usr/local/pgsql/data |--= 09688 postgres postgres: logger process |--= 09690...SQL引擎 流程 1 语法解析 SQL解析成语法树,只检查语法错误 testdb=# SELECT id, data FROM tbl_a WHERE id WHERE clauses....: freeze PG用一个计算距离的算法来计算两个事务的差值,用差值计算决定两个事务的先后关系。
Zabbix社区签约专家 ZbxTable是由张思德先生自主开发的开源的Zabbix报表系统,支持分析和导出,还拓展了GraphTree的功能,对统计消息数据是强有力的补充。...zabbix/zabbix_agentd.conf.d/*.conf 重启 Zabbix Agent 3.脚本 Bug 修复 正常添加后,已经可以看到部分数据,观察 Zabbix Server 日志,会发现如下错误信息...: Preprocessing failed for: psql:/var/lib/zabbix/postgresql/pgsql.dbstat.sql:17: ERROR: field name must...:17: ERROR: field name must not be null' 观察 PostgreSQL 监控指标,确实有部分 item 显示为 unsupported 状态,查询资料后发现是由于...temp_bytes, deadlocks FROM pg_stat_database WHERE
pgSQL function transaction_test1() line 6 at COMMIT COMMIT; 1.4 不支持:事务块内调用【带事务控制的匿名块】 START TRANSACTION...WHERE last_name = 'Banda'; SAVEPOINT banda_sal; UPDATE employees SET salary = 12000 WHERE...rollback的效果是完全一样的,都会结束掉当前事务 rollback to savepoint sp1; ERROR at line 1: ORA-01086: savepoint 'SP1'...即函数、或事务块内的场景为true;过程为false。 atomic如何确定?...不能仅仅使用状态机函数CommitTransaction,需要加上commit或rollback的底层处理函数。
如何排查和修复常见的配置错误。 1. Apache 基础配置概述 Apache 的配置文件通常位于 /etc/apache2/ 目录下。...**ErrorLog ${APACHE_LOG_DIR}/error.log**:定义错误日志的位置,存储 Apache 在运行时发生的错误。...如何排查和修复 Apache 配置错误 在配置 Apache 时,我们可能会遇到一些常见的错误,比如语法错误、权限设置不正确或文件路径错误。接下来,我们将基于以下步骤详细讲解如何排查并修复这些问题。...例如: DocumentRoot /var/www/html/yourdomain # 这是根目录 上述配置会引发语法错误,因为 Apache 会错误地将注释视为配置的一部分。...问题 3:检查 Apache 错误日志 如果 Apache 服务启动失败或虚拟主机无法工作,最好的方法是检查 Apache 的错误日志: sudo tail -f /var/log/apache2/error.log
/html/custom_404.html echo "I have no idea where that file is, sorry....在CentOS 7上,主服务器块位于/etc/nginx/nginx.conf文件中。...我们现在可以将Nginx指向我们的自定义错误页面。 将404错误直接发送到自定义404页面 CentOS Nginx配置文件已使用error_page指令定义了404错误页面。...如果没有返回语法错误,请键入以下命令重新启动Nginx: sudo systemctl restart nginx 现在,当您转到服务器的域或IP地址并请求不存在的文件时,您应该看到我们设置的404页面...结论 您现在应该为您的网站提供自定义错误页面。即使遇到问题,这也是一种简化用户体验个性化的方法。对这些页面的一个建议是加入指向他们可以获取帮助或更多信息的位置的链接。
18024 CREATE_18024_SYNTAX DDL语句语法错误的详细信息。 DDL语句语法错误,请参考DDL文档进行修改,或进一步联系技术支持。...DDL操作获取ZK锁失败,请稍后重试,或进一步联系技术支持。...20013 INSERT_20013_SYNTAX INSERT语句语法错误的详细信息。 INSERT语句语法错误,请按照提示修改。...20018 DELETE_20018_SYNTAX DELETE语句语法错误的详细信息。 DELETE语句语法错误,请按照提示修改。...Dump data在获取upload id阶段失败,请参考详细信息,或进一步提工单。
Mysql或Oracle迁移到Postgresql系产品后,经常会发生事务回滚导致的问题,具体问题一般都是类似于: 为什么我没rollback,我的事务就自己回滚了?...建表语句 create table t1 (i int); 我们可以猜一下三次selectAllFromTable(函数就是简单的查全表)输出会是什么 用Mysql或Oracle的同学可能直接就可以想到...这里就不再贴报错了,我贴下单步调试的过程更容易理解 第一个差异点:事务内SQL报错后,再执行任何语句都会抛异常 在报错后的事务内再执行查询,报PG的标准错误: org.postgresql.util.PSQLException...方案一:PL/pgSQL 使用Postgresql提供的PL/pgSQL语法,将相关逻辑写入PG的函数中,使用PG的EXCEPTION语法封装响应的处理逻辑,在业务代码中调用函数即可保证事务不会中断。...occurs, this for 方案二:寻找替代逻辑,避免事务内产生错误 例如这样的业务逻辑(一个真实的业务场景): On Oracle伪代码 try select xxx from t1
mysql 修改root密码提示1064语法错误问题解决 centos7安装mysql8.0.13时候,mysql 修改root密码时总是提示1064语法错误,尝试使用如下语句修改root密码,出现错误提示如下...mysql> set password for root@localhost = password('123456'); ERROR 1064 (42000): You have an error in...PASSWORD() 5.7以后的版本可以用authentication_string() 操作时password改为authentication_string后,仍发现还提示错误 mysql> update...user set authentication_string=password('123456') where user='root'; ERROR 1064 (42000): You have an...syntax to use near '("123456") where user="root"' at line 1 1 2 3 再次使用安装时方法提示密码不符合规则 mysql> ALTER USER
下表为腾讯游戏 GCS 平台(Game Cloud Storage)统计2012.7.1~2013.7.1 一年SQL变更单据语法错误的结果。...表1 2012.7.1~2013.7.1的单据语法错误统计 从上表可以看出,变更因语法错误导致的失败率为3.3%,平均每2天有一个变更失败是因为语法错误。... 包含一条出错语句,里面再分 、error_code>、error_msg> 和 四部分来输出出错SQL语句的信息。...点开语法错别的链接,可得如下详细语法错误信息,同 MySQL 的表现完全一致。...图7 点击语法错误信息后所示 SQL 审核工具除了能够检测语法错误,还是提示高危的 SQL 语句给 DBA,减少 DBA 审单的压力,下图为高危告警的示例图: 图8 GCS平台高危告警示例图
最好是使用高速稳定的VPN下载官方源。 下载时总是出现 fetch failed , early EOF 这样的错误。...services start nginx Or, if you don't want/need a background service you can just run: nginx 补充 #测试配置是否有语法错误...很大可能是root目录配置错误。 特别是nginx.conf中,分别需要对 .php和默认的 root设置。 忽略其中一个可能就造成找不到文件。.../_/ Composer version 2.0.11 2021-02-24 14:57:23 安装扩展 extensions for php php-zip 下载,或使用...(建议添加在 extensions部分) ;extension=pdo_odbc ;extension=pdo_pgsql ;extension=pdo_sqlite ;extension=pgsql
logging_collector = on # Enable capturing of stderr and csvlog log_directory = 'pg_log' # directory where...'on' datestyle = 'iso, mdy' timezone = 'PRC' lc_messages = 'en_US.UTF-8' # locale for system error message...# 缺省拷贝方式升级的命令,(硬链接方式升级的命令只需要添加 -k 或者 --link) su - postgres /usr/pgsql-11/bin/pg_upgrade -b /usr/pgsql...有时候,pgsql大版本升级,psql连接问题会报这个错误:undefined symbol: PQsetErrorContextVisibility 解决方法: su - postgres ... vim .bash_profile 加一行 export LD_LIBRARY_PATH=/usr/pgsql-10/lib 没有ZFS的情况下的,pg的升级建议: 1、新加一台pg流复制从库
这个错误通常发生在配置文件 authz 中存在语法错误或配置不当的情况下。本文将详细介绍这个错误的原因、如何检查和修复它。1. 什么是 authz 文件?...路径错误:配置文件中指定的路径不存在或拼写错误。权限设置不合理:权限设置可能导致冲突或无法解析。3. 检查和修复3.1 检查语法错误首先,打开 authz 文件并仔细检查每一行的语法。...这个错误通常表示SVN服务器上的权限配置文件(通常是authz文件)存在语法错误或配置不当。实际应用场景有一个SVN仓库,用于管理一个团队的代码。...“Invalid authz configuration”错误通常是因为 authz 文件中的语法错误或配置不当引起的。...检查日志文件查看 SVN 服务器的日志文件,以获取更多关于错误的详细信息。日志文件通常位于 /var/log/ 目录下。
编写UDF的语言可以是SQL、C、Java、Perl、Python、R和pgSQL。...PL/pgSQL自动在所有HAWQ数据库中安装。 PL/pgSQL函数参数接收任何HAWQ服务器所支持的标量数据类型或数组类型,也可以返回这些数据类型。...除此之外,PL/pgSQL还可以接收或返回任何自定义的复合数据类型,也支持返回单行记录(record类型)或多行结果集(setof record或table类型)。...图5 但是在HAWQ中,同样的查询会报如图6所示的错误。 ? 图6 单独查询表函数是可以的。...图14 但是,HAWQ不支持with recursive语法,同样的查询,会返回如图15所示的错误。 ?
• CLIENT_ERROR:执行错误。...• ERROR:保存出错或语法错误。 • EXISTS:在最后一次取值后另外一个用户也在更新该数据。 • NOT_FOUND:Memcached 服务上不存在该键值。 ....• ERROR:语法错误或删除失败。 • NOT_FOUND:key 不存在。...• CLIENT_ERROR:自增值不是对象。 • ERROR 其他错误,如语法错误等。...• CLIENT_ERROR:自增值不是对象。 • ERROR 其他错误,如语法错误等。 5、 stats 命令 stats 命令用于返回统计信息例如 PID(进程号)、版本号、连接数等。
就会显示错误: ServeSrs sql db.Prepare error发生意外。...(语法错误或违反访问规则) 代码如下: db, err0 := sql.Open("adodb", cfg.Cfg["mssql"]) if err0 !...[Web2019_roomlist] b where a.roomid = ?...) temp_row where rownumber>((?...defer stmt1.Close() rows, err := stmt1.Query(pageid, pagesize) OK,先自己拼接字符串,再喂给mssql 的adodb
领取专属 10元无门槛券
手把手带您无忧上云